I''m trying to follow a simple tutorial at
http://wiki.rubyonrails.org/rails/pages/Tutorial,
I run
./script/generate controller hello index
but it pulls up a 500 error when I access the page.
The error logs say:
/!\ FAILSAFE /!\ Fri Jun 20 18:06:54 -0700 2008
Status: 500 Internal Server Error
Secret should be something secure, like
"a6259536bb7e2a1974a2cabefaa1c61b". The value you provided,
"<%app_secret %>", is shorter than the minimum leng
th of 30 characters
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/session/cookie_store.rb:92:in
`ensure_secret_secure''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/session/cookie_store.rb:57:in
`initialize''
/usr/lib/ruby/1.8/cgi/session.rb:273:in `new''
/usr/lib/ruby/1.8/cgi/session.rb:273:in
`initialize_without_cgi_reader''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/cgi_ext/session.rb:39:in
`initialize''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/cgi_process.rb:130:in
`new''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/cgi_process.rb:130:in
`session''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/cgi_process.rb:166:in
`stale_session_check!''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/cgi_process.rb:114:in
`session''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/base.rb:1141:in
`assign_shortcuts_without_flash''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/flash.rb:167:in
`assign_shortcuts''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/base.rb:518:in
`process_without_filters''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/filters.rb:685:in
`process_without_session_management_support''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/session_management.rb:123:in
`process''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/base.rb:388:in
`process''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/dispatcher.rb:171:in
`handle_request''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/dispatcher.rb:115:in
`dispatch''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/dispatcher.rb:126:in
`dispatch_cgi''
/home/johnwa/Desktop/downloads/rails/vendor/rails/actionpack/lib/action_controller/dispatcher.rb:9:in
`dispatch''
/home/johnwa/Desktop/downloads/rails/vendor/rails/railties/lib/webrick_server.rb:112:in
`handle_dispatch''
/home/johnwa/Desktop/downloads/rails/vendor/rails/railties/lib/webrick_serve
Any ideas?
-John Watson
john.watson-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org
--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ups
"Ruby on Rails: Talk" group.
To post to this group, send email to
rubyonrails-talk-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org
To unsubscribe from this group, send email to
rubyonrails-talk-unsubscribe-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org
For more options, visit this group at
http://groups.google.com/group/rubyonrails-talk?hl=en
-~----------~----~----~----~------~----~------~--~---
John Watson wrote:> I''m trying to follow a simple tutorial at > http://wiki.rubyonrails.org/rails/pages/Tutorial, > I run > > ./script/generate controller hello index > > but it pulls up a 500 error when I access the page. > The error logs say: > > /!\ FAILSAFE /!\ Fri Jun 20 18:06:54 -0700 2008 > Status: 500 Internal Server Error > Secret should be something secure, like > "a6259536bb7e2a1974a2cabefaa1c61b". The value you provided, "<%> app_secret %>", is shorter than the minimum leng > th of 30 characterslooks like you started your application after they added secrets, but before they made the min length = 30. try running "rake secret" and copy and paste what it generates into config/environment.rb config.action_controller.session = { :session_key => ''_festible_session'', :secret => *your secret* } -- Posted via http://www.ruby-forum.com/. --~--~---------~--~----~------------~-------~--~----~ You received this message because you are subscribed to the Google Groups "Ruby on Rails: Talk" group. To post to this group, send email to rubyonrails-talk-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org To unsubscribe from this group, send email to rubyonrails-talk-unsubscribe-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org For more options, visit this group at http://groups.google.com/group/rubyonrails-talk?hl=en -~----------~----~----~----~------~----~------~--~---